Oracle數據庫循環表

我有一個oracle數據庫,我正在運行下面的查詢

select table_name
from db_test.test
where table_name like '%20170128'

這將返回一列,其中所有表的末尾都有特定日期。我怎樣才能得到這個列表并查詢它們?

? 最佳回答:

您需要動態SQL。如果您對每個表運行一個簡單的查詢(在本例中,我只是執行一個count(*)),那么類似的操作就可以了

declare
  l_cnt integer;
  l_sql varchar2(1000);
begin 
  for t in (select table_name
              from db_test.test
             where table_name like '%20170128')
  loop
    l_sql := 'select count(*) from ' || t.table_name;
    execute immediate l_sql
                 into l_cnt;
    dbms_output.put_line( t.table_name || ' has ' || l_cnt || ' rows.' );
  end loop;
end;
主站蜘蛛池模板: 国模精品一区二区三区视频| 国产成人亚洲综合一区| 精品人体无码一区二区三区| 国产伦理一区二区| 国产成人欧美一区二区三区| 久久精品国产一区二区电影| 日韩电影一区二区三区| 婷婷国产成人精品一区二| 综合一区自拍亚洲综合图区| 中文字幕av人妻少妇一区二区| 国产激情一区二区三区| 一区二区日韩国产精品| 国产一区在线视频观看| 日韩成人一区ftp在线播放| 亚洲日韩AV无码一区二区三区人 | 亚洲.国产.欧美一区二区三区| 亚洲一区精品无码| 国产精华液一区二区区别大吗| 国产精品xxxx国产喷水亚洲国产精品无码久久一区 | 亚洲国产欧美日韩精品一区二区三区| 亚洲av鲁丝一区二区三区| 国模无码人体一区二区| 国产综合无码一区二区辣椒| 精品乱人伦一区二区三区| 亚洲AV日韩AV天堂一区二区三区| 久久免费区一区二区三波多野| 无码精品人妻一区二区三区漫画 | 无码日韩精品一区二区三区免费| 国精产品一区二区三区糖心| 无码人妻一区二区三区在线视频| 久久久久久免费一区二区三区| 亚洲AV午夜福利精品一区二区| 麻豆文化传媒精品一区二区| 久久精品黄AA片一区二区三区| 精品人妻一区二区三区浪潮在线| 无码国产精品一区二区免费3p| 无码一区二区三区老色鬼| 人妻av无码一区二区三区| 无码国产精品一区二区免费I6| 色婷婷亚洲一区二区三区| 亚洲国产精品第一区二区三区|